The Mighty He-Goat - The Greek Empire.

‘And as I was considering, behold a he-goat came from the west over the face of the whole earth and did not touch the ground. And the goat had a notable horn between its eyes.'

As we are specifically told later (Daniel 8:21) this he-goat represents Greece, to the west of the Persian empire. Greece had been well known for centuries as a source of trade, and it had provided contingents of very effective mercenaries for foreign armies, including the Egyptian and Persian armies. ‘Over the face of the whole earth' means the Mediterranean ‘earth', but now stretching into Europe as well. ‘Did not touch the ground.' They skimmed over the ground, demonstrating the speed of their conquests. The notable horn was no doubt Alexander the Great.
